Note: I could not unpack … Web28 apr. 2024 · dig command stands for Domain Information Groper. It is used for retrieving information about DNS name servers. It is basically used by network administrators. It is used for verifying and troubleshooting DNS problems and to perform DNS lookups. Dig command replaces older tools such as nslooku p and the host. The dig command is part of the bind-utils package and can be installed … Web1 mei 2024 · The dig +short command (such as described in "dig show only answer") is great for batch processing names into IP addresses. It does a simple job and does it well. Unfortunately when there's a CNAME even +short isn't short enough. For example: $ dig +short docs.sbonds.org ghs.google.com. 173.194.69.121 cheap racks https://bigwhatever.net
